History:

Lynne gave a brief talk about the history of the piano in the building. It was recently tuned and it’s ivories replaced by Tom Denker of Port Wing – professional piano tuner. This was paid for by Doc Chisholm in preparation for his Musical Evening. The piano is the Club’s third piano. It was made in 1908, making it 111 years old as of this writing.
